Java Object 获取值的实现流程
在Java开发中,我们经常需要从对象中获取值。下面我将向你介绍一种方法来实现“Java Object 获取值”的操作。
流程概述
下面是整个流程的概览:
步骤 | 描述 |
---|---|
1 | 创建一个Java类 |
2 | 在类中定义属性 |
3 | 使用构造函数初始化属性 |
4 | 提供公共的访问方法 |
5 | 创建对象并获取属性值 |
接下来,我们将逐步介绍每个步骤需要做什么,以及具体的代码实现。
1. 创建一个Java类
首先,我们需要创建一个Java类,可以使用任何文本编辑器创建一个以.java为后缀名的文件。例如,我们可以创建一个名为Person的类。
public class Person {
// 属性和方法将在后面的步骤中添加
}
2. 在类中定义属性
在上一步中创建的类中,我们需要定义一些属性。属性可以是基本类型(如整数、字符串等),也可以是其他类的对象。例如,我们可以在Person类中添加一个name属性。
public class Person {
private String name;
}
3. 使用构造函数初始化属性
在Java中,我们通常使用构造函数来初始化对象的属性。在Person类中,我们可以添加一个带有一个参数的构造函数来初始化name属性。
public class Person {
private String name;
public Person(String name) {
this.name = name;
}
}
4. 提供公共的访问方法
为了能够从外部访问类的属性,我们需要提供公共的访问方法,也称为getter方法。在Person类中,我们可以添加一个getName()方法来获取name属性的值。
public class Person {
private String name;
public Person(String name) {
this.name = name;
}
public String getName() {
return name;
}
}
5. 创建对象并获取属性值
最后,我们可以创建Person类的对象,并使用getter方法来获取属性的值。
public class Main {
public static void main(String[] args) {
Person person = new Person("John");
String name = person.getName();
System.out.println("Name: " + name);
}
}
上述代码将输出结果为:"Name: John",这样我们就成功地从Person对象中获取了name属性的值。
序列图
下面是一个使用mermaid语法标识的序列图,展示了整个流程的交互过程:
sequenceDiagram
participant 小白
participant 开发者
小白->>开发者: 向开发者请教如何获取Java对象的值
开发者-->>小白: 解释整个流程
小白->>开发者: 跟随指引进行操作
开发者-->>小白: 提供详细的代码示例和解释
饼状图
下面是一个使用mermaid语法标识的饼状图,展示了代码实现各个部分的比例:
pie
"创建Java类" : 10
"定义属性" : 20
"初始化属性" : 15
"提供访问方法" : 30
"创建对象并获取值" : 25
在以上代码中,我们按照步骤依次完成了创建Java类、定义属性、初始化属性、提供访问方法以及创建对象并获取值的操作。通过这些步骤,我们可以轻松地从Java对象中获取值。
希望这篇文章对你理解“Java Object 获取值”的实现流程有所帮助!